The kind folks at the Bristol Folk Festival have teamed up with UK Festival Guides and given us two pairs of weekend tickets for you to get your hands on.  This fantastic prize gives you the opportunity for you and a friend to experience one of the best folk festivals the UK has to offer, Bristol Folk Festival.  What's more it is held at the fabulous Colston Hall, so for all your festival goers worried about the weather, fear not, you can stay warm and dry whilst listening to some of the finest folk musicians the world has to offer.

This years fantastic line up includes the not to be missed Show of Hands, Cara Dillion, Afro Celt Sound System, 3 Daft Monkeys, Rua Macmillan to name but a few.  Not only that but for the second year running this years patron is the hugely successful and talented Seth Lakeman, here is what he has to say:

“After last year’s hugely successful return to the UK’s live music calendar, I am delighted to be patron once again for Bristol Folk Festival 2012. With an eclectic line-up of multi-award winning, and up-and-coming folk and acoustic acts there is something for everyone.”
